Csharp ienumerable where

WebQ将是IpDTO类型的IEnumerable,并执行Q.ToList().ForEach(i=>i.PAINTIP(i));我会对结果做一个预测。这不是你想要的吗?我只需要使用IP调用PAINTIP函数,我在select:IP=z.select(x=>x.IP)中有IP。Distinct()IP可以提供丢失的IP号,函数PAINTIP只接收一个IP并绘制其历史。 WebSince the Select expression is returning the combined result, which is then processed, I'd imagine explicitly using the KeyValuePair value type would allow you to avoid any sort of heap allocations, so long as the .NET impl allocates value types on the stack and any state machine which LINQ may generate uses a field for the Select'd result which isn't …

How to tell if an IEnumerable is subject to deferred execution?

WebIEnumerable is the base interface for all non-generic collections that can be enumerated. For the generic version of this interface see System.Collections.Generic.IEnumerable. IEnumerable contains a single method, GetEnumerator, which returns an IEnumerator. IEnumerator provides the ability to iterate through the collection by exposing a ... WebSep 2, 2010 · If you want to sort a collection of strings in-place, you need to sort the original collection which implements IEnumerable, or turn an IEnumerable into a sortable collection first: List myList = myEnumerable.ToList (); myList.Sort (); _components = (from c in xml.Descendants ("component") let value = (string)c orderby ... sharon music ada oh https://martinezcliment.com

How Do Enumerators and Enumerables Work in C#? - How-To Geek

WebMay 23, 2024 · @Miryafa .Any () is an extension method that operates on IEnumerable (or IQueryable, although that's a different scenario). Doing so consumes the … WebDec 22, 2024 · The IEnumerable interface is the base for all the non-generic collections that can be enumerated. It exposes a single method GetEnumerator (). This method returns a … WebOct 25, 2024 · Here is the output: We can see that in the Test class we implemented the IEnumerable interface. Within the constructor we are creating a few objects of the Test class and added a method to add the objects of the Test class one by one. The GetEnumerator method will return an object of the Test class one by one because we … sharon music gillingham

c# - How to select items from IEnumerable? - Stack …

Category:c# - Create IEnumerable .Find() - Stack Overflow

Tags:Csharp ienumerable where

Csharp ienumerable where

How to check if IEnumerable is null or empty? - Stack Overflow

Web当然,Select返回一个IEnumerable。Select的结果是与Select标准匹配的所有项目-因此为什么结果类型是IEnumerable,因为结果可以是从零到多个选定项目的任何内容…您介意删除您的答案以便我可以删除此问题吗?是的,我介意。 WebSep 29, 2024 · C# class UnManagedWrapper where T : unmanaged { } The where clause may also include a constructor constraint, new (). That constraint makes it …

Csharp ienumerable where

Did you know?

http://duoduokou.com/csharp/50866211260672535394.html WebSep 15, 2024 · A where clause may contain one or more methods that return Boolean values. In the following example, the where clause uses a method to determine whether the current value of the range variable is even or odd. C#. class WhereSample3 { static void Main() { // Data source int[] numbers = { 5, 4, 1, 3, 9, 8, 6, 7, 2, 0 }; // Create the query …

WebSep 2, 2010 · IEnumerable describes behavior, while List is an implementation of that behavior. When you use IEnumerable, you give the compiler a chance to defer work … WebSep 29, 2024 · See also. An iterator can be used to step through collections such as lists and arrays. An iterator method or get accessor performs a custom iteration over a collection. An iterator method uses the yield return statement to return each element one at a time. When a yield return statement is reached, the current location in code is remembered.

WebTo convert a dictionary with a list to an IEnumerable in C#, you can use LINQ's SelectMany method to flatten the dictionary and convert each key-value pair to a sequence of tuples. Here's an example: In this example, we use SelectMany to flatten the dictionary and convert each key-value pair to a sequence of tuples (key, value), where value is ...

WebMay 23, 2024 · @Miryafa .Any() is an extension method that operates on IEnumerable (or IQueryable, although that's a different scenario).Doing so consumes the sequence, at least partially (although that still means it is consumed) - it might only need to read one element (especially if there is no predicate).As such, since sequences …

http://duoduokou.com/csharp/17084714953905810795.html sharon musickWebApr 10, 2024 · Now, to get each enrollment id, the name of the student, and the name of the course we need to perform a select operation on the join result. Let’s create a new method, GetEnrolments (): public static IEnumerable GetEnrolments(. IEnumerable enrolments) {. pop up screen in power appsWebJan 7, 2014 · IEnumerable cars; cars.Find(car => car.Color == "Blue") Can I accomplish this with extension methods? The following fails because it recursively calls itself rather than calling IList.Find(). sharon mutual calendarWebOct 29, 2024 · IEnumerable in C# is an interface that defines one method, GetEnumerator which returns an IEnumerator interface. This allows readonly access to a collection then … popup screen in powerappsWebSep 15, 2024 · This fact means it can be queried with LINQ. A query is executed in a foreach statement, and foreach requires IEnumerable or IEnumerable. Types that support IEnumerable or a derived interface such as the generic IQueryable are called queryable types. A queryable type requires no modification or special treatment to … popup screen in html variableWebThese are the top rated real world C# (CSharp) examples of IEnumerable.Where extracted from open source projects. You can rate examples to help us improve the quality of … sharon muthuWebJul 31, 2012 · IEnumerable is an interface, instead of looking for how to create an interface instance, create an implementation that matches the interface: create a list or an array. IEnumerable myStrings = new [] { "first item", "second item" }; IEnumerable myStrings = new List { "first item", "second item" }; sharon music school